Structural engineer services involve evaluating the stability and integrity of building frameworks to ensure they meet safety standards and design specifications. These professionals perform detailed assessments of existing structures or provide calculations and plans for new constructions. Their work often includes analyzing load-bearing capacities, identifying potential weaknesses, and recommending necessary modifications or reinforcements to prevent structural failures. This service is essential in both the planning and maintenance phases of property development and renovation projects.
Many common problems are addressed through structural engineering services, including signs of structural distress such as cracking, sagging, or uneven settling. These issues can compromise the safety and usability of a property if not properly diagnosed and remedied. Structural engineers help identify the root causes of such problems, evaluate the severity, and suggest appropriate solutions. Their expertise ensures that repairs or modifications are effective, durable, and compliant with relevant building codes.

The overview below groups typical Structural Engineer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mooresville, IN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Design Consultation Costs - Typically, structural engineering design consultations range from $500 to $2,500, depending on project complexity. For example, a small residential extension might cost around $700, while a large commercial project could be closer to $2,000.
Per-Project Fees - The overall cost for structural engineering services often falls between $1,000 and $10,000. Smaller projects, like a home remodel, may cost around $1,500, whereas large-scale developments could reach $8,000 or more.
Hourly Rates - Structural engineers may charge hourly rates ranging from $100 to $250 per hour. A typical residential assessment might take 10-20 hours, resulting in costs from $1,000 to $5,000 depending on the scope.
Additional Service Charges - Extra services such as detailed reports or on-site inspections can add $200 to $1,000 to the total. For example, a detailed foundation analysis might cost approximately $600, depending on project specifics.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Structural engineering services are often sought after by property owners in Mooresville, IN when planning significant renovations or additions. For example, if a homeowner wants to expand their living space or add a new garage, a structural engineer can assess the existing foundation and framing to ensure the new construction will be safe and stable. Additionally, property owners may require structural evaluations after experiencing events like heavy storms or shifting ground, to determine if repairs are needed to maintain the integrity of the building.
Another common reason for seeking structural engineering services involves inspections for real estate transactions or insurance purposes. When buying or selling a property in Mooresville, property owners might request a structural assessment to identify potential issues that could impact the value or safety of the home. Similarly, those considering remodeling projects, such as removing load-bearing walls or upgrading support structures, often consult with local pros to ensure modifications meet safety standards and are properly supported.
